Cinnamon-Candy Cookies Recipe

Ingredients:  
Ingredients:  
2/3 cup Red Hots Cinnamon Hearts
2 1/3 cups flour
1 cup butter, softened
1 teaspoon vanilla extract

Frosting
2 cups confectioners sugar
1/2 cup butter, softened
1/2 teaspoon vanilla or cinnamon extract
4-6 tablespoons 2% milk

Directions:
Directions:
Place cinnamon candies in a food processor or blender. Process until fine and powdery. Add flour; pulse to combine.
In a large bowl, cream butter and sugar until light and fluffy. Beat in vanilla. Gradually beat flour into creamed mixture.
Shape dough into two 8 inch rolls; wrap each in plastic wrap. Refrigerate dough until firm at least an hour.
Preheat oven to 350º. Unwrap dough and cut into 1/4 inch slices. Place 2 inches apart on ungreased baking sheets. Bake 7-9 or until edges are just light brown. Cool on pans 2 minutes before removing to wire racks to cool completely.
For frosting, in a small bowl beat confectioner's sugar, butter, extract and enough milk to reach desired consistency.
Decorate cookies as desired.

Number Of Servings:
Number Of Servings:
5 dozen
